Internships Opportunities

4

Students can pursue summer internships with faculty members at ANDC. Some examples of summer internship projects include: Isolation and cluster classification of Mycobacteriophages from soil samples Survey of prevalence of Diabetes in college going youth of Delhi NCR Effects of Lantana camara weed extract on the survival and midgut histoarchitecture of Aedes aegypti L. ANDC also has a number of other programs and facilities, including: Entrepreneurship Laboratory (EL) Established in 2013, EL provides a space for students to develop their entrepreneurial skills and set up small enterprises.

Fees and Financial Aid

Fee in this college is very low in comparison to other college and don't think it is because of poor facilities but it is due to our college is funded by government. My first year fee was 9915, second year was 8915 and third year fee is 13224. You can get various scholarships according to the course you have opt, one of them is Teena Gupta Memorial scholarship,SAKSHAM Student aid for fellowship, Savitri Singh scholarship and the list goes on.

Campus Life

3.5

Leiothrixx is the name of annual fest here in ANDC. In previous it was held in the month of April. In library, you can find your almost every course related reference books ( more than 2 copies) And our library is equipped with RFID management system. In our college you can participate in various indoor and outdoor games like football, volleyball, basketball, cricket,chess,carrom,table tennis, badminton and more. A group of student have established their start-up inside our college BookWithUVA which is growing well.

Admission

Eligibility of this course is that applicant should have passed 12th class from recognised board. From year 2022 application are made via CSAS counseling that uses the score of CUET examination, in this exam you have to select mathematics with 2 other subjects (that you have studied in your 12th class) and obtain score to get admission here. After giving CUET you have to apply for CSAS counseling that control the process of admission in DU. CSAS portal will show you the alloted college and course as per as your marks and preference list. Students of category SC/ST/OBC/EWS get both relaxation on fee and marks criteria.
